A US-essentially based entirely AI recruitment firm got right here to IIT-Delhi for placement and assured the students that they is no longer going to hesitate to sponsor H-1Bs on account of the $100,000 rate that the Donald Trump administration imposed, so as that corporations rely on American skill and develop no longer import foreign abilities.
The firm’s social media advertising and marketing also focused the H-1B teach, the worries over the excessive expenses and established their message that the $100,000 rate is no longer going to cease them from hiring the supreme. “We want to work in India for sure. But the exposure one gets abroad, in a diverse and fast-moving environment, is different. Strict visa rules are a big setback. So companies offering sponsorship is a huge thing for us,” a student counseled news company PTI.In line with social media buzz, the AI firm is San Francisco’s Metaview, and the firm’s co-founder ran a same advertising and marketing campaign after the Trump administration launched the H-1B visa rate. Shahriar Tajbakhsh, the co-founder and CTO, acknowledged $100,000 is a rounding error when put next to the value every member of the group creates. “If you’re on an H-1B visa and your company doesn’t value you enough to pay the $100k, check out to see if any of our roles might be a fit,” he wrote.

Our team is ready to move fast and get to an offer/no-offer decision on any candidate within 24 hours of first contact. However, there’s a catch.
Candidates should spare 4-5 hours of their time for interviews,” Tajbaksh wrote. “Our company is looking to expand in the US, and we plan to submit more H-1B petitions in the next lottery. One executive order will not change my belief that an organization’s success or failure is a function of its people,” Tajbaksh counseled Enterprise Insider, explaining his social media publish. Tajbaksh got right here to the US thru EB-1A visa which is an employment-essentially based entirely visa supposed for these with unparalleled abilities within the sciences, arts, education, exchange or athletics.The H-1B row has yet again taken the centerstage after President Donald Trump acknowledged in a Fox interview that US needs determined expertise from outside, riling up a share of MAGA who needs the H-1B program to be suspended.
